Matthew Hayden has the second highest number of international centuries for Australia.

Matthew Hayden is a former Australian cricketer and opening batsman who scored centuries (100 or more runs) in Test matches and One Day International (ODI) matches organised by the International Cricket Council (ICC). He was described by Yahoo! Cricket as "a strong-built left-hander, an intimidating personality and [possessing] an aggressive attitude", "[with] all the ingredients" needed for success.[1] Hayden scored 8,625 runs in Tests and 6,133 runs in ODIs, accruing 40 centuries.[1] He was named one of the Indian Cricket Cricketers of the Year in 2001, and Wisden Cricketers of the Year two years later.[2][3] Hayden was chosen as the "ICC ODI Cricketer of the Year" for his accomplishments with the bat in 2007.[4][5]

Hayden made his Test debut against South Africa in March 1994.[6] His first century came three years later against the West Indies at the Adelaide Oval when he scored 125.[7] It took another four years to score his second international century. Hayden scored centuries against all the Test cricket playing nations, except Bangladesh.[7] His highest score of 380 came against Zimbabwe at the WACA Ground, Perth in 2003,[6] surpassing Brian Lara's world record of 375.[8] Lara beat Hayden's total when he scored 400 not out in a match against England in April 2004.[9][N 1] Hayden scored centuries in each innings of a Test match on two different occasions.[11]

Hayden made his ODI debut in 1993.[6] He achieved his first century against India at the Indira Priyadarshini Stadium, Visakhapatnam in 2001.[12] He made ten centuries against five different opponents,[13] and was most successful against New Zealand and India, scoring four and three centuries against each of them respectively.[13] Hayden's highest score of 181 not out was against New Zealand in 2007,[12] and was an Australian record at the time.[N 2] His century against South Africa in the 2007 Cricket World Cup came off 66 balls, the quickest by an Australian to date.[15] Hayden was the leading run-scorer in the tournament, with 658 runs which included three centuries.[16][17]

Hayden played nine Twenty20 International (T20I) matches, between 2005 and 2007; he failed to score a century in any game, recording a high score of 73 not out.[18] After representing his country for over 15 years, Hayden retired from international cricket in 2009.[19] As of February 2015, he is eleventh in the list of century-makers in international cricket in all formats combined.[20]
